How to make Snowmen Rice Krispie Treats

After making the rice krispie treats, it is time to form the snowmen.

Before I got started, I got out my round shortbread cookies so I could compare the sizes when forming the heads.

I also did this very important step: Sprayed a bit of non-stick cooking spray on my hands. This allowed me to work with the Rick Krispie Treats without getting stuck to them.

Roll the treats into balls to form the snowman’s head.

After forming the heads, it is time to make the hats.

Dip the round shortbread cookies into the dark chocolate melting wafers.

Next, cover the large marshmallows in the dark chocolate and add them to the top of the cookies.

To attach the hats to the snowmen’s heads, I put a dab of dark chocolate on the top of the heads and put the hats on top. When the chocolate cools, it holds the hats on.

The nose was a bit of work. The noses you see are actually the second noses the snowmen got.

I originally just had a dot like the eyes and mouth. So, I added more candy melts and made a swirl.

The previous nose actually helped to support the new nose. I think it actually looks more like a carrot now.

Snowmen Rice Krispie Treats Recipe

I was able to make about 14 snowmen with this recipe. The amount will vary depending on how big you make your snowmen.

Ingredients

Snowmen Heads (Rice Krispie Treats)

  • 3 tbs butter
  • 1 tsp pure vanilla
  • 16 oz mini marshmallows
  • 6 cups Rice Krispie Cereal

Hats

  • Round Shortbread Cookies
  • Large Marshmallows
  • Dark Chocolate Melting Wafers

Facial Features for Snowmen

  • Dark Chocolate Melting Wafers
  • Orange Candy Melts

Instructions

Snowmen Heads (Rice Krispie Treats)

  • In a large pot, melt the butter.
  • Add the vanilla and bag of mini marshmallows. Stir constantly until the marshmallows are melted.
  • Stir in the Rice Krispie Cereal.
  • Spray a bit of non-stick cooking spray on your hands and form the treats into round balls.

Hats

  • Melt the dark chocolate melting wafers according to the directions.
  • Dip the top of the cookies into the chocolate and place on wax paper to cool.
  • Cover the large marshmallows with the chocolate and add to the top of the cookies to complete the hats.
  • Allow to cool before adding to the snowmen heads.

Snowmen Faces

  • Use the remaining chocolate from the hats or melt more if needed. Put it in a ziploc bag and cut a small hole in one corner.
  • Pipe dots on the snowmen heads for coal eyes and mouth.
  • Melt the orange candy melts according to the directions.
  • Put the candy melts into a ziploc bag and cut a small hole in the corner.
  • Pipe a dot onto the head for the nose.
  • After cooling, pipe a swirl over the dot to make a carrot type nose.

Adding the hats to the Snowmen

  • Pipe a bit of chocolate to the top of the snowmen heads.
  • Place the hat on top. You may need to hold in place for a bit to allow the chocolate to cool enough to hold it in place.
